Переход с S7-300 на S7-1500 — это задача модернизации существующей системы управления Siemens S7 с заменой центрального контроллера, переносом проекта в TIA Portal и адаптацией аппаратной конфигурации, программы и сетевого обмена. Такой переход применяется на действующих производственных линиях, насосных станциях, упаковочном оборудовании, инженерных системах и в шкафах автоматики, где ранее использовались контроллеры Siemens S7-300. Основная цель — перевести объект на актуальную платформу PLC Siemens с более современной архитектурой, расширенной диагностикой, удобной инженерной средой и большим набором коммуникационных функций. На практике модернизация PLC Siemens почти всегда затрагивает не только CPU, но и структуру данных, HMI, сетевые соединения, сигнальные модули, схемы резервирования и сервисное обслуживание. Поэтому миграция должна рассматриваться как инженерный проект, а не как простая замена одного процессора на другой.
Что представляет собой миграция S7-300 на S7-1500
Обновление SIMATIC S7-300 до платформы S7-1500 означает перенос логики управления со старой архитектуры STEP 7 Classic на современную среду TIA Portal с последующей адаптацией проекта под новую CPU. На первом этапе переносится исходный проект, после чего выполняется отдельная операция замены CPU на S7-1500, проверка блоков, интерфейсов и адресации. Важно учитывать, что при таком переходе не все решения переносятся автоматически: часть аппаратной конфигурации и отдельных программных конструкций требует ручной переработки.
Основные функции и роль модернизации в промышленной автоматизации
Миграция нужна для сохранения работоспособности действующей АСУ ТП, упрощения дальнейшего обслуживания и перевода системы на единую инженерную среду. После перехода предприятие получает более удобную диагностику, более гибкую конфигурацию сетевого обмена, доступ к новым CPU, технологиям motion и safety, а также возможность развивать систему без сохранения жесткой зависимости от старой платформы. В инженерном смысле переход с S7-300 на S7-1500 — это не только замена контроллера, но и нормализация архитектуры проекта: переход к более прозрачной структуре блоков, пересмотру обмена с HMI и SCADA, а также проверке качества исходной программы.
Основные линейки оборудования
S7-300. Базовая модульная платформа, на которой построено большое количество действующих шкафов автоматики. Чаще всего именно она является исходной точкой модернизации.
S7-1500 Standard CPU. Основная линейка для дискретной и общей промышленной автоматизации. Подходит для большинства задач замены стандартных CPU S7-300.
S7-1500 Compact CPU. Исполнение с интегрированными входами и выходами для компактных машин и ограниченного пространства шкафа.
S7-1500F. Линейка для систем, где вместе со стандартной логикой требуется реализовать функции функциональной безопасности.
S7-1500T. Контроллеры для задач motion control, позиционирования, синхронизации и управления осями.
S7-1500R/H. Исполнения для систем с повышенными требованиями к отказоустойчивости и доступности.
Где применяется такая модернизация
- при обновлении шкафов управления на действующем производстве;
- при переносе проекта из STEP 7 Classic в TIA Portal;
- при замене CPU 31x на более производительный контроллер Siemens;
- при переводе объекта на PROFINET, новую HMI или расширенную диагностику;
- при поэтапной модернизации, когда часть системы временно остается на S7-300.
Таблица характеристик перехода
| Параметр | Особенность миграции |
|---|---|
| Инженерная среда | Перенос проекта из STEP 7 V5.x в TIA Portal |
| Замена CPU | Выполняется отдельным шагом после миграции проекта |
| Аппаратная конфигурация | Часть центральных модулей подбирается и добавляется вручную |
| Программные блоки | Требуют проверки после компиляции и адаптации под S7-1500 |
| Доступ к данным | После миграции часто требуется пересмотр стандартного и optimized block access |
| STL/AWL-логика | Отдельные конструкции и обращения через регистры требуют ручной переработки |
| Связь со старой системой | Возможна поэтапная работа S7-300 и S7-1500 через S7 connection |
| Результат модернизации | Переход на актуальные контроллеры Siemens и развитие системы в TIA Portal |
Основные критерии выбора оборудования
Класс исходного CPU. Перед заменой нужно сопоставить производительность существующего S7-300 с целевой CPU S7-1500 по времени цикла, объему памяти и числу соединений.
Структура ввода-вывода. Нужно определить, какие модули остаются, какие подлежат замене, и будет ли система строиться как центральная или распределенная.
Тип программы. Если в проекте много STL/AWL, косвенной адресации, старых библиотек или нестандартных вызовов, объем ручной доработки возрастает.
Сетевой обмен. При модернизации необходимо проверить связи с HMI, SCADA, приводами, удаленными станциями и сторонними контроллерами.
Требования по технологии. Если объекту нужны safety, motion или высокая доступность, выбирать нужно не просто S7-1500, а соответствующую серию F, T или R/H.
Стратегия останова. Для действующего производства важно заранее определить, будет ли миграция выполняться за один останов или поэтапно с временным обменом между S7-300 и S7-1500.
FAQ
Можно ли перенести проект S7-300 на S7-1500 без переписывания программы?
Нет, такой сценарий нельзя считать гарантированным. Базовый проект переносится в TIA Portal, но после этого обычно требуется ручная проверка и корректировка блоков, аппаратной конфигурации и адресного доступа.
Нужно ли менять все модули шкафа при переходе на S7-1500?
Не всегда. Состав замены зависит от архитектуры станции, типа центральных модулей, схемы ввода-вывода и выбранной стратегии модернизации.
Что чаще всего вызывает проблемы при миграции?
На практике основные риски связаны со старыми STL/AWL-конструкциями, обращением к данным по абсолютным адресам, библиотечными блоками, обменом с HMI и нестандартной коммуникацией.
Можно ли модернизировать объект поэтапно?
Да, такой вариант применяют на действующих линиях. На переходный период S7-300 и S7-1500 могут обмениваться данными через настроенное S7-соединение.
Какой CPU S7-1500 выбирать взамен S7-300?
Выбор делают не по названию серии, а по фактической задаче: производительности, числу соединений, объему программы, требованиям по safety, motion и структуре I/O.
Вывод
Переход с S7-300 на S7-1500 — это инженерная модернизация системы управления с переносом проекта, заменой CPU, проверкой аппаратной части и адаптацией программы под современную архитектуру Siemens S7. Такой переход позволяет перевести действующий объект на актуальную платформу PLC Siemens, но требует предварительного технического аудита и понимания ограничений исходного проекта. В промышленной автоматизации качественно выполненная миграция снижает риски обслуживания устаревших решений и создает основу для дальнейшего развития АСУ ТП.
